Description
This dataset contains in-situ measurements of temperature, salinity, and velocity from the Sub-Mesoscale Ocean Dynamics Experiment (S-MODE) conducted approximately 300 km offshore of San Francisco, during an intensive observation period in the fall of 2022. The data are available in netCDF format with a dimension of time. S-MODE aims to understand how ocean dynamics acting on short spatial scales influence the vertical exchange of physical and biological variables in the ocean. The target in-situ quantities were measured by Lagrangian floats, which were deployed from research vessels and retrieved 3-5 days later. The floats follow the 3D motion of water parcels at depths within or just below the mixed layer and carried a CTD instrument to measure temperature, salinity, and pressure, in addition to an ADCP instrument to measure velocity.

Variables
The table below lists the variables contained within a single granule for this dataset. Variables often contain observed or derived geophysical measurements collected from a variety of sources, including remote sensing instruments on satellite and airborne platforms, field campaigns, in situ measurements, and model outputs. The terms variable, parameter, scientific data set, layer, and band have been used across NASA’s Earth science disciplines; however, variable is the designated nomenclature in NASA’s Common Metadata Repository (CMR). Variable metadata attributes such as Name, Description, Units, Data Type, Fill Value, Valid Range, and Scale Factor allow users to efficiently process and analyze the data. The full range of attributes may not be applicable to all variables. Additional information on variable attributes is typically available in the data, user guide, and/or other product documentation.
